You can book all kinds of spaces: sports-bar-style venues like Nash Bar and Stage, high-end seafood or steakhouse restaurants like Crudo, or interactive entertainment restaurants like Brighton Bowl and F1 Arcade. Many listings offer both seated dining and standing capacity, with flexible layouts to suit anything from cocktail parties to formal dinners.

The Seaport District stands out for high-energy venues with delicious menus and great entertainment, making it excellent for large-scale parties. The Financial District is another hotspot, with centrally located spaces that suit both casual celebrations and corporate events. South End party restaurants have a mix of trendy and upscale environments, while Brighton and Cambridge give you spacious, budget-friendly options away from the city centre.

Yes, many places will let you book out a private room or section rather than the entire venue. It's perfect if you've got a smaller group or want to keep things more low-key. For example, at places like Baleia or The Smoke Shop BBQ, you'll find smaller private areas that still feel special without the full buyout price.

Most restaurants will let you party until 11 PM or midnight, sometimes even later if it's a private event. Some places, like those in the Financial or Seaport Districts, are built for nightlife and can stay open past midnight, especially on weekends. Always check ahead, but Boston has many late-night-friendly bars and restaurants if you're looking to stretch the night.
